PGConsumer Staples

Procter & Gamble is a Dividend King with 68+ consecutive years of dividend increases. Its portfolio of iconic brands includes Tide, Pampers, Gillette, and Oral-B. Global presence in 70+ countries with pricing power that has consistently delivered real dividend growth above inflation.
